Domestic silver prices
As of 9:15 am on September 18, the price of 999 silver (1 tael) of DOJI Jewelry Group Joint Stock Company was listed at the threshold of 2.305 - 2.405 million VND/tael (buying - selling), an increase of 94,000 VND/tael in both directions compared to yesterday morning.
The price of silver bars 2024 Ancarat 999 (1 tael) at Ancarat Gem Company is listed at the threshold of 2.207 - 2.273 million VND/tael (buying - selling), an increase of 69,000 VND/tael on the buying side and 71,000 VND/tael on the selling side compared to yesterday morning.
The price of silver ingots 2025 Ancarat 999 (1kg) at Ancarat Gem Company is listed at 58.314 - 60.114 million VND/kg (buying - selling), an increase of 1.844 million VND/kg on the buying side and 1.894 million VND/kg on the selling side compared to yesterday morning.
At the same time, the price of 999 silver bars (1 tael) at Phu Quy Jewelry Group was listed at the threshold of 2.237 - 2.306 million VND/tael (buying - selling), an increase of 68,000 VND/tael on the buying side and 70,000 VND/tael on the selling side compared to yesterday morning.

The price of 999 silver ingots (1kg) at Phu Quy Jewelry Group is listed at 59.653 - 61.493 million VND/kg (buying - selling), an increase of 1.814 million VND/kg on the buying side and 1.867 million VND/kg on the selling side compared to yesterday morning.
World silver price
On the world market, as of 9:15 am on September 18 (Vietnam time), the world silver price was listed at 65.87 USD/ounce, up 2.60 USD/ounce compared to yesterday morning.

Causes and forecasts
Silver prices continue to rise as the market continues to analyze the latest interest rate decision of the US Federal Reserve (Fed).
Silver prices at times exceeded 66 USD/ounce, the highest level in the past 5 days. At the same time, the decline in US Treasury bond yields has partly put pressure on the USD, creating more favorable conditions for the prices of precious metals.
The decline in oil prices is also seen as a silver supporting factor, contributing to reducing concerns about inflationary pressure. If inflation expectations cool down, bond yields may face further downward pressure, thereby supporting non-performing assets such as silver.
However, the outlook for silver prices is still influenced by US monetary policy. The Fed has raised interest rates by 25 basis points, bringing the target interest rate margin to 3.75-4%. This is the first interest rate hike by the US central bank in three years.
The decision to raise interest rates was made in the context of high inflation in the US, while the economy continues to maintain its strength. New forecasts from policymakers also show that the possibility of further interest rate hikes is still being considered this year.
According to CME FedWatch tool, the market currently forecasts about 55% chance of the Fed raising interest rates at the October meeting. Meanwhile, the yield of 10-year US Treasury bonds is still near 5%, a factor that may limit the recovery momentum of silver prices.
